Trans Adriatic Pipeline Launches Market Test

TAP launched a market test to allow natural gas shippers to express interest, and in a later phase, secure access to new, long-term capacity in TAP, thereby enabling the future expansion of the pipeline capacity. The market test will be conducted in two main phases: a non-binding phase, starting on 1 July 2019, followed by a binding phase, expected to start earliest in the second quarter of 2020.

TAP closes Market Test

Trans Adriatic Pipeline AG (TAP) announces the closure of the binding Booking Phase that had been launched in March this year and, thereby, the completion of the Market Test. As a result of this Market Test, additional capacity will be provided at TAP’s entry point at the Turkey-Greece border and additional exit points will become available along the route.

2019 Market test

The 2019 Market Test has ended and no binding bids have been submitted. Interested parties are encouraged to follow the 2021 Market Test process, which was launched on 12 July 2021. You can find all relevant information here. Market tests are held at least every two years following the operation of TAP. ESIA Italy (in English)

TAP submitted its updated Environmental and Social Impact Assessment (ESIA) to the Italian Ministry of the Environment and Protection of Land and Sea on 10th of September 2013. The latest stage in a process, started in March 2012, will now see the final documentation go to consultation with all relevant national, regional and local authorities.
